Not recognized points about hurricane harm coverage incorporate the presence of anti-concurrent causation clauses in many procedures. These clauses state that if problems success from the two a protected and uncovered peril, the complete assert may very well be denied. For instance, if wind (a protected peril) and flooding (perhaps uncovered) each contributed on the destruction, your insurer might deny compensation. An additional generally-disregarded stage is examining for concealed destruction. Water intrusion can weaken foundations, rot Wooden, and result in mildew expansion. The 2-minute rule for hurricane hurt inspection will be to look over and above the plain. Verify attics, crawlspaces, and powering partitions. Mold can variety in as small as forty eight several hours, and untreated mildew challenges may become both of those health and fitness dangers and insurance policies nightmares.
